"""Pydantic schemas for AI generation endpoints."""
from typing import Any
from pydantic import BaseModel
class ChatMessage(BaseModel):
role: str # "user" | "assistant" | "system"
content: str
class ChatRequest(BaseModel):
model: str
messages: list[ChatMessage]
temperature: float = 0.7
max_tokens: int = 1024
class ChatResponse(BaseModel):
id: str
model: str
content: str
usage: dict[str, Any] | None = None
class ModelInfo(BaseModel):
id: str
name: str
context_length: int | None = None
pricing: dict[str, Any] | None = None
# --- Text generation ---
class TextRequest(BaseModel):
model: str
prompt: str
system_prompt: str | None = None
temperature: float = 0.7
max_tokens: int = 1024
class TextResponse(BaseModel):
id: str
model: str
content: str
usage: dict[str, Any] | None = None
# --- Image generation ---
class ImageRequest(BaseModel):
model: str
prompt: str
n: int = 1
size: str = "1024x1024"
class ImageResult(BaseModel):
url: str | None = None
b64_json: str | None = None
revised_prompt: str | None = None
class ImageResponse(BaseModel):
id: str
model: str
images: list[ImageResult]
# --- Video generation ---
class VideoRequest(BaseModel):
model: str
prompt: str
duration_seconds: int | None = None
aspect_ratio: str = "16:9"
class VideoFromImageRequest(BaseModel):
model: str
image_url: str
prompt: str
duration_seconds: int | None = None
aspect_ratio: str = "16:9"
class VideoResponse(BaseModel):
id: str
model: str
status: str # "queued" | "processing" | "completed"
video_url: str | None = None
metadata: dict[str, Any] | None = None

"""AI router: model listing and chat completions via OpenRouter."""
from fastapi import APIRouter, Depends, HTTPException, status
from backend.app.dependencies import get_current_user
from backend.app.models.ai import ChatRequest, ChatResponse, ModelInfo
from backend.app.services import openrouter
router = APIRouter(prefix="/ai", tags=["ai"])
@router.get("/models", response_model=list[ModelInfo])
async def get_models(_: dict = Depends(get_current_user)) -> list[ModelInfo]:
"""List available AI models from OpenRouter."""
try:
raw = await openrouter.list_models()
except Exception as exc:
raise HTTPException(
status_code=status.HTTP_502_BAD_GATEWAY,
detail=f"OpenRouter error: {exc}",
)
return [
ModelInfo(
id=m.get("id", ""),
name=m.get("name", m.get("id", "")),
context_length=m.get("context_length"),
pricing=m.get("pricing"),
)
for m in raw
]
@router.post("/chat", response_model=ChatResponse)
async def chat(
body: ChatRequest,
_: dict = Depends(get_current_user),
) -> ChatResponse:
"""Send a chat completion request through OpenRouter."""
try:
result = await openrouter.chat_completion(
model=body.model,
messages=[m.model_dump() for m in body.messages],
temperature=body.temperature,
max_tokens=body.max_tokens,
)
except Exception as exc:
raise HTTPException(
status_code=status.HTTP_502_BAD_GATEWAY,
detail=f"OpenRouter error: {exc}",
)
try:
choice = result["choices"][0]
return ChatResponse(
id=result["id"],
model=result.get("model", body.model),
content=choice["message"]["content"],
usage=result.get("usage"),
)
except (KeyError, IndexError) as exc:
raise HTTPException(
status_code=status.HTTP_502_BAD_GATEWAY,
detail=f"Unexpected response format from OpenRouter: {exc}",
)

"""Generate router: text, image, video, and image-to-video generation."""
from fastapi import APIRouter, Depends, HTTPException, status
from backend.app.dependencies import get_current_user
from backend.app.models.ai import (
ImageRequest,
ImageResponse,
ImageResult,
TextRequest,
TextResponse,
VideoFromImageRequest,
VideoRequest,
VideoResponse,
)
from backend.app.services import openrouter
router = APIRouter(prefix="/generate", tags=["generate"])
@router.post("/text", response_model=TextResponse)
async def generate_text(
body: TextRequest,
_: dict = Depends(get_current_user),
) -> TextResponse:
"""Generate text from a prompt using a chat model."""
messages = []
if body.system_prompt:
messages.append({"role": "system", "content": body.system_prompt})
messages.append({"role": "user", "content": body.prompt})
try:
result = await openrouter.chat_completion(
model=body.model,
messages=messages,
temperature=body.temperature,
max_tokens=body.max_tokens,
)
except Exception as exc:
raise HTTPException(
status_code=status.HTTP_502_BAD_GATEWAY, detail=f"OpenRouter error: {exc}")
try:
choice = result["choices"][0]
return TextResponse(
id=result["id"],
model=result.get("model", body.model),
content=choice["message"]["content"],
usage=result.get("usage"),
)
except (KeyError, IndexError) as exc:
raise HTTPException(status_code=status.HTTP_502_BAD_GATEWAY,
detail=f"Unexpected response format: {exc}")
@router.post("/image", response_model=ImageResponse)
async def generate_image(
body: ImageRequest,
_: dict = Depends(get_current_user),
) -> ImageResponse:
"""Generate images from a text prompt."""
try:
result = await openrouter.generate_image(
model=body.model,
prompt=body.prompt,
n=body.n,
size=body.size,
)
except Exception as exc:
raise HTTPException(
status_code=status.HTTP_502_BAD_GATEWAY, detail=f"OpenRouter error: {exc}")
try:
images = [
ImageResult(
url=item.get("url"),
b64_json=item.get("b64_json"),
revised_prompt=item.get("revised_prompt"),
)
for item in result.get("data", [])
]
return ImageResponse(
id=result.get("id", ""),
model=result.get("model", body.model),
images=images,
)
except (KeyError, TypeError) as exc:
raise HTTPException(status_code=status.HTTP_502_BAD_GATEWAY,
detail=f"Unexpected response format: {exc}")
@router.post("/video", response_model=VideoResponse)
async def generate_video(
body: VideoRequest,
_: dict = Depends(get_current_user),
) -> VideoResponse:
"""Generate a video from a text prompt."""
try:
result = await openrouter.generate_video(
model=body.model,
prompt=body.prompt,
duration_seconds=body.duration_seconds,
aspect_ratio=body.aspect_ratio,
)
except Exception as exc:
raise HTTPException(
status_code=status.HTTP_502_BAD_GATEWAY, detail=f"OpenRouter error: {exc}")
return VideoResponse(
id=result.get("id", ""),
model=result.get("model", body.model),
status=result.get("status", "queued"),
video_url=result.get("video_url"),
metadata=result.get("metadata"),
)
@router.post("/video/from-image", response_model=VideoResponse)
async def generate_video_from_image(
body: VideoFromImageRequest,
_: dict = Depends(get_current_user),
) -> VideoResponse:
"""Generate a video from an image and a text prompt."""
try:
result = await openrouter.generate_video_from_image(
model=body.model,
image_url=body.image_url,
prompt=body.prompt,
duration_seconds=body.duration_seconds,
aspect_ratio=body.aspect_ratio,
)
except Exception as exc:
raise HTTPException(
status_code=status.HTTP_502_BAD_GATEWAY, detail=f"OpenRouter error: {exc}")
return VideoResponse(
id=result.get("id", ""),
model=result.get("model", body.model),
status=result.get("status", "queued"),
video_url=result.get("video_url"),
metadata=result.get("metadata"),
)

"""Tests for AI endpoints — OpenRouter HTTP calls are fully mocked."""
import os
import pytest
import pytest_asyncio
from unittest.mock import AsyncMock, patch
from httpx import AsyncClient, ASGITransport
from backend.app.main import app
from backend.app import db as db_module
os.environ.setdefault("JWT_SECRET", "test-secret-key-for-testing-only")
os.environ.setdefault("OPENROUTER_API_KEY", "test-key")
FAKE_MODELS = [
{"id": "openai/gpt-4o", "name": "GPT-4o", "context_length": 128000, "pricing": {"prompt": "0.000005"}},
{"id": "anthropic/claude-3-haiku", "name": "Claude 3 Haiku", "context_length": 200000, "pricing": {}},
]
FAKE_CHAT_RESPONSE = {
"id": "gen-abc123",
"model": "openai/gpt-4o",
"choices": [{"message": {"role": "assistant", "content": "Hello! How can I help?"}}],
"usage": {"prompt_tokens": 10, "completion_tokens": 8, "total_tokens": 18},
}
@pytest.fixture(autouse=True)
def fresh_db():
db_module._conn = None
db_module.init_db(":memory:")
yield
db_module.close_db()
db_module._conn = None
@pytest_asyncio.fixture
async def client(fresh_db):
transport = ASGITransport(app=app)
async with AsyncClient(transport=transport, base_url="http://test") as ac:
yield ac
async def _user_token(client):
await client.post("/auth/register", json={"email": "user@example.com", "password": "secret123"})
resp = await client.post("/auth/login", json={"email": "user@example.com", "password": "secret123"})
return resp.json()["access_token"]
# ---------------------------------------------------------------------------
# GET /ai/models
# ---------------------------------------------------------------------------
async def test_list_models(client):
token = await _user_token(client)
with patch(
"backend.app.routers.ai.openrouter.list_models",
new_callable=AsyncMock,
return_value=FAKE_MODELS,
):
resp = await client.get("/ai/models", headers={"Authorization": f"Bearer {token}"})
assert resp.status_code == 200
data = resp.json()
assert len(data) == 2
assert data[0]["id"] == "openai/gpt-4o"
assert data[1]["name"] == "Claude 3 Haiku"
async def test_list_models_unauthenticated(client):
resp = await client.get("/ai/models")
assert resp.status_code == 401
async def test_list_models_upstream_error(client):
token = await _user_token(client)
with patch(
"backend.app.routers.ai.openrouter.list_models",
new_callable=AsyncMock,
side_effect=Exception("Connection refused"),
):
resp = await client.get("/ai/models", headers={"Authorization": f"Bearer {token}"})
assert resp.status_code == 502
assert "OpenRouter error" in resp.json()["detail"]
# ---------------------------------------------------------------------------
# POST /ai/chat
# ---------------------------------------------------------------------------
async def test_chat_success(client):
token = await _user_token(client)
with patch(
"backend.app.routers.ai.openrouter.chat_completion",
new_callable=AsyncMock,
return_value=FAKE_CHAT_RESPONSE,
):
resp = await client.post(
"/ai/chat",
json={
"model": "openai/gpt-4o",
"messages": [{"role": "user", "content": "Hello"}],
},
headers={"Authorization": f"Bearer {token}"},
)
assert resp.status_code == 200
data = resp.json()
assert data["id"] == "gen-abc123"
assert data["model"] == "openai/gpt-4o"
assert data["content"] == "Hello! How can I help?"
assert data["usage"]["total_tokens"] == 18
async def test_chat_passes_parameters(client):
token = await _user_token(client)
mock = AsyncMock(return_value=FAKE_CHAT_RESPONSE)
with patch("backend.app.routers.ai.openrouter.chat_completion", new_callable=AsyncMock, return_value=FAKE_CHAT_RESPONSE) as mock:
await client.post(
"/ai/chat",
json={
"model": "anthropic/claude-3-haiku",
"messages": [{"role": "user", "content": "Hi"}],
"temperature": 0.3,
"max_tokens": 512,
},
headers={"Authorization": f"Bearer {token}"},
)
mock.assert_called_once_with(
model="anthropic/claude-3-haiku",
messages=[{"role": "user", "content": "Hi"}],
temperature=0.3,
max_tokens=512,
)
async def test_chat_unauthenticated(client):
resp = await client.post(
"/ai/chat",
json={"model": "openai/gpt-4o", "messages": [{"role": "user", "content": "Hi"}]},
)
assert resp.status_code == 401
async def test_chat_upstream_error(client):
token = await _user_token(client)
with patch(
"backend.app.routers.ai.openrouter.chat_completion",
new_callable=AsyncMock,
side_effect=Exception("timeout"),
):
resp = await client.post(
"/ai/chat",
json={"model": "openai/gpt-4o", "messages": [{"role": "user", "content": "Hi"}]},
headers={"Authorization": f"Bearer {token}"},
)
assert resp.status_code == 502
async def test_chat_malformed_upstream_response(client):
token = await _user_token(client)
with patch(
"backend.app.routers.ai.openrouter.chat_completion",
new_callable=AsyncMock,
return_value={"id": "x", "choices": []}, # empty choices
):
resp = await client.post(
"/ai/chat",
json={"model": "openai/gpt-4o", "messages": [{"role": "user", "content": "Hi"}]},
headers={"Authorization": f"Bearer {token}"},
)
assert resp.status_code == 502
